OH MY.......after reading NUMEROUS blogs and reviews about the Woolee Winder I had sort of mixed emotions and expectations, but with a money back guarantee figured I couldn't go wrong.


After all the research I assumed that I would have to fiddle around with setting everything just "so" and was concerned about all the tension issues I have read about. NOT SO!!!! I swapped out the flyer and Bada BING.....I was in spinning heaven!!!!!!


I truly think that the double drive vs single drive/scotch tension is what the difference is!!! It seems like 99% of the folks with tension issues are using single drive/scotch tension wheels. It sounds like the tension is so much different than with the regular flyer.

I think if you have a single drive wheel and are considering buying a Woolee Winder, GO AHEAD AND GET IT.......it sounds like you are going to have to be patient and work with it to get the tension set....but once you do, it will be well worth it!!! (some smart person should make a utube video on how to set up with a single drive wheel).
I have read a lot of reviews from folks that just gave up on getting the tension set but use it to ply and swear it is worth it's weight in gold if you use it for nothing more than plying.
